Luka Doncic’s Legacy Needs an NBA Championship to Cement His Place as Best European Player

At this point we are not going to discover Luka Doncic as a basketball player. The Slovenian is the soul of the Dallas Mavericks and one of the best in the NBA; so much so that he is currently in the race for the MVP of the 2023-24 campaign. However, something is still missing.

That’s exactly what Tony Parker, legend of the San Antonio Spurs and French basketball, talks about when asked if Doncic is in the discussion about the best European player of all time. The Frenchman does not doubt the talent of the Mavs star, but he does emphasize a detail that he understands takes him out of the fight with other great players from the old continent.

«In my opinion, for a player to be part of the debate about the best European player of all time, he needs to win a championship. That’s just my personal opinion. I love the discussion about the best. I always have that conversation with my brother and my friends. In my opinion, if you don’t know what it takes to win a championship, you shouldn’t be part of the discussion about the greatest of all time,” says Parker in statements reported by Eurohoops.

Parker may not be wrong. Doncic’s numbers and basketball are at the top, but the next step must be to truly be in the fight to be NBA champion, and so far his ceiling has been the 2022 Western Conference finals. We’re talking about the NBA, obviously, since in 2017 he was proclaimed Eurobasket champion when he was only 18 years old.
